
Instant Pot Chickpea Curry That’ll Make Your Kitchen Smell Amazing
There’s something truly magical about the moment when aromatic spices hit hot oil in your Instant Pot. The sizzle, the burst of fragrance, the promise of comfort food that’s about to fill your home—it never gets old! If you’ve been searching for a foolproof way to make restaurant-quality chana masala at home, you’ve just struck gold.
This Instant Pot chickpea curry recipe transforms humble ingredients into a rich, soul-warming dish that’ll have your family asking for seconds (and thirds!). The best part? Your pressure cooker does most of the heavy lifting while you sit back and enjoy those incredible aromas wafting through your kitchen.
Whether you’re a seasoned cook or just starting your Indian cuisine adventure, this recipe breaks down every step so clearly that success is practically guaranteed. Get ready to discover why this beloved dish has been bringing families together around dinner tables for generations!
Why This Instant Pot Version Will Become Your Go-To Recipe
Traditional chana masala requires hours of slow simmering to achieve that perfect, creamy texture where the chickpeas practically melt in your mouth. Your Instant Pot cuts that time dramatically while delivering the same incredible depth of flavor that makes this dish so beloved.
The pressure cooking process works like magic—it infuses every chickpea with those warming spices while creating a rich, thick gravy that clings to each bite. Plus, you can use either dried chickpeas soaked overnight or convenient canned ones, making this recipe flexible enough for both planned meals and spontaneous dinner cravings.
I still remember the first time I made this recipe for my skeptical neighbor who insisted that “real” chana masala could only come from her favorite Indian restaurant. One bite, and she was practically demanding I share the recipe! That’s the power of perfectly spiced, home-cooked comfort food.
Gathering Your Flavor Arsenal
The beauty of this chickpea curry lies in its accessibility. Most ingredients are pantry staples, and the few specialty items are worth seeking out for the authentic flavor they bring.
The Foundation:
- 2 cups dried chickpeas (soaked overnight) OR 2 cans cooked chickpeas (rinsed & drained)
- 2 medium onions, finely chopped
- 2 medium tomatoes, blended or finely chopped
- 2 green chilies, slit lengthwise
- 2 tablespoons ginger-garlic paste
- ½ cup oil or ghee
Aromatic Whole Spices:
- 2-3 bay leaves
- 1 black cardamom (optional but recommended!)
- 1 cinnamon stick
- 2 teaspoons cumin seeds
The Spice Blend That Creates Magic:
- 2 teaspoons coriander powder
- 1 teaspoon turmeric powder
- 1 teaspoon garam masala
- 1½ teaspoons red chili powder (adjust to your heat preference)
- 1 tablespoon chana masala powder
- 1 teaspoon salt
For the Perfect Finish:
- 4 cups water (for dried chickpeas) OR 1½ cups (for canned)
- Fresh coriander leaves, chopped
- Lemon wedges
- Thinly sliced fresh ginger
Pro tip: If you can’t find chana masala powder at your local grocery store, check the international aisle or visit an Indian spice shop. This blend is what gives the curry its distinctive, restaurant-quality flavor!
Creating Your Culinary Masterpiece
Building the Aromatic Base
Set your Instant Pot to Sauté mode and let it heat up. Add your oil or ghee—I personally love using ghee for its rich, nutty flavor that adds another layer of depth to the dish. Once the oil shimmers, add the cumin seeds, bay leaves, cinnamon stick, and black cardamom.
Listen for that satisfying splutter and watch the spices dance in the hot oil. This technique, called tempering, releases essential oils from the whole spices and creates an aromatic foundation that’ll make your entire house smell incredible.
Add the finely chopped onions and sauté them patiently until they turn a beautiful golden brown. This step is crucial—those caramelized onions contribute natural sweetness and depth that you simply can’t achieve by rushing the process.
Building Layers of Flavor
Once your onions are perfectly golden, add the ginger-garlic paste and slit green chilies. Sauté for 1-2 minutes until the raw smell disappears and the mixture becomes fragrant. The kitchen should be smelling absolutely divine at this point!
Add your tomatoes (whether blended smooth or finely chopped) and cook until the oil starts separating from the mixture. This usually takes about 5-7 minutes and signals that the moisture has evaporated and the flavors have concentrated beautifully.
Now comes the moment where the real magic happens—add all your ground spices: coriander powder, turmeric, red chili powder, chana masala powder, and salt. Stir everything together and let it cook for about a minute. The spices should be fragrant but not burnt.
The Pressure Cooking Magic
Add your chickpeas—whether you’re using the soaked dried ones or convenient canned chickpeas, both work beautifully in this recipe. Pour in the appropriate amount of water, give everything a good stir, and taste the liquid to adjust salt if needed.
Close that Instant Pot lid, make sure your valve is set to sealing, and set it to Pressure Cook on High. For soaked dried chickpeas, cook for 30-35 minutes. If you’re using canned chickpeas, 10 minutes is plenty since they’re already tender.
When the cooking time is complete, let the pressure release naturally. I know it’s tempting to do a quick release, but the natural release helps the chickpeas maintain their texture while continuing to absorb those incredible flavors.
The Final Flourish
Once the pressure has released completely, open the lid and take a moment to appreciate what you’ve created. The chickpeas should be tender, and the curry should have a rich, thick consistency.
Turn on Sauté mode again if you’d like to adjust the thickness. For an even creamier texture, gently mash a few chickpeas against the side of the pot with your spoon—this helps thicken the gravy naturally and gives it that authentic, restaurant-style consistency.
Stir in the garam masala for that final burst of warming spices, then taste and adjust seasoning as needed.
Serving Your Creation with Style
Ladle your aromatic chickpea curry into bowls and garnish generously with chopped fresh coriander, thin slices of fresh ginger, and a squeeze of bright lemon juice. The contrast of the warm, earthy curry with the fresh, bright garnishes creates a perfect balance.
This curry pairs beautifully with fluffy basmati rice, warm naan bread, or soft rotis. I love serving it family-style with a variety of sides so everyone can customize their perfect bite.
Frequently Asked Questions
Can I make this ahead of time?
Absolutely! This curry actually tastes even better the next day as the flavors continue to meld. Store it in the refrigerator for up to 4 days or freeze for up to 3 months.
What if I don’t have chana masala powder?
While chana masala powder gives authentic flavor, you can substitute with an extra teaspoon of garam masala mixed with ½ teaspoon each of cumin powder and amchur (dried mango powder) if you have it.
Can I make this less spicy?
Definitely! Reduce the red chili powder to ½ teaspoon and remove the seeds from the green chilies before adding them.
Why are my chickpeas still hard after cooking?
Old chickpeas take longer to soften. If using dried chickpeas, ensure they’re soaked for at least 8 hours, and don’t add acidic ingredients like tomatoes until after they’re tender.
Your Kitchen Adventure Awaits
There’s something deeply satisfying about creating a dish that brings such comfort and joy to your dinner table. This Instant Pot chickpea curry isn’t just a recipe—it’s your gateway to exploring the rich, warming flavors of Indian cuisine from the comfort of your own kitchen.
Each time you make this curry, you’ll likely discover small ways to make it your own. Maybe you’ll add a handful of spinach in the final minutes, or perhaps you’ll experiment with different levels of heat. That’s the beauty of home cooking—every pot tells a story.
So fire up that Instant Pot, gather your spices, and get ready to fill your home with the most incredible aromas. Your family is in for a real treat tonight!